This study explores the discrepancies between bulk mechanics and spatial mapping in a tissue‐mimetic hydrogel model. Microplastic particles create localized stiff mechanical microenvironments that are detectable by cellular‐scale nanoindentation but leave bulk properties unchanged as measured by rheology.

Entropy‐Driven Design of Low‐Melting‐Point Alloys via Compositionally Complex Strategy
Conventional low‐melting‐point alloys (LMPAs) are limited by a narrow compositional space and inherent property trade‐offs. This review presents an entropy‐driven design strategy that overcomes these limitations, ushering in a new class of low‐melting‐point compositionally complex alloys (LMCCAs).

Design of a Multistable Finger Prosthesis with Programmable Metamaterials
This research article shows the development of a multistable programmble metamaterial for the use as a finger prosthesis. The material was designed on different hierarchical levels where the influence of geometrical parameters and combination of mechanical elements was explored.
